Archilochus alexandri (Black Chinned Hummingbird) is a species of birds in the family hummingbirds. They are listed in cites appendix ii. They are native to The Nearctic. They visit flowers of white sage, tree tobacco, wax mallow, and Ipomoea pauciflora pauciflora. They are diurnal. They rely on flight to move around.
